1. Grease and oil

Grease and oil can solidify in your pipes and cause clogs. Even if it seems like hot grease will wash away easily, it will eventually cool and harden, sticking to your pipes and causing problems. After a while, enough grease can build up along with other materials to completely block your drain. To avoid this, pour used grease into a container and dispose of it in the trash. 2. Wet wipes

Wet wipes may be advertised as flushable, but they don’t break down like toilet paper does. They are made to maintain their shape in water. As a result, they can cause clogs and blockages in your pipes and plumbing system. To avoid this, throw used wet wipes in the trash instead of flushing them down the toilet.

3. Q-tips, cotton balls and makeup pads

Generally, products made from cotton absorb water. They don’t break down when soaked in water. Like wet wipes, Q-tips, cotton balls, and makeup pads don’t break down easily and can cause clogs. They can also get caught on other objects in your pipes and cause blockages. To avoid this, don’t flush them down the toilet.

4. Mortar, grease, adhesives, and similar DIY and craft supplies

Things that stick or harden as they dry should never go down your drain. Mortar, grease, adhesives, and other DIY and craft supplies are not meant to be flushed down the drain. They can cause clogs and blockages. Many of these materials are also toxic. If they leak into your drinking water, they can contaminate it and make you sick. In the end, you’ll spend more time and money dealing with the mess than if you had just disposed of these materials properly in the first place.

5. Kitty litter regarded as flushable

Kitty litter may be advertised as flushable, but it’s not really meant to be flushed down the toilet. It doesn’t break down well and can cause clogs. Plus, it can be harmful to your septic system. If you must dispose of kitty litter, the best way to do it is to scoop it into a plastic bag and throw it in the trash.
